The size of your yacht is another critical factor. Smaller yachts are easier to maneuver in tight marina spaces, while larger ones offer more amenities and comfort. Think about how many people you plan to accommodate and what kind of space you will need for storage and living.
The internal layout of the yacht plays a vital role in your overall sailing experience. Look for designs that maximize space and functionality. Ensure there are sufficient sleeping quarters, a well-equipped galley, and comfortable living areas. An open-plan design often enhances the flow of the space, allowing for better social interactions.
Sailing the Mediterranean should be a luxurious experience. Look for yacht designs that incorporate comfortable seating, modern amenities, and stylish interiors. Features like air conditioning, high-quality furnishings, and spacious decks will enhance your onboard experience.
Not all yacht manufacturers are created equal. Research reputable builders known for their craftsmanship and innovative designs. Brands with a strong presence in the Mediterranean sailing community have likely tailored their yachts to withstand the region's unique weather and conditions.
Choosing a yacht design also involves considering maintenance. Some materials and designs require more upkeep than others. Opting for a yacht that is easier to maintain will save you time and money in the long run, allowing you to enjoy more time on the water.
When in doubt, reaching out to experts can provide invaluable insights. Yacht brokers and sailing consultants can offer professional advice based on your preferences and sailing plans. They often have access to numerous designs and can help you find the perfect fit in no time.
Before making a final decision, arrange for trial sails to get a feel for how each yacht handles. Assessing the yacht’s performance, comfort, and overall experience during an actual sail can confirm whether it meets your expectations.
